Android-Based Infotainment System Coming to Some GM Models by 2016



News abóut Góógle's Andróid Autó has been circulating since earlier this year as an answer tó Apple's CarPlay, but Autómótive News repórts General Mótórs will móve fórward with a different Andróid-based infótainment system fór sóme óf its módels by 2016. Unlike Andróid Autó, which essentially just piggybacks ón an Andróid phóne's sóftware, this infótainment system wóuld feature a fully integrated Andróid óperating system.

Supplier Harman Internatiónal will be respónsible fór building the new Andróid-based infótainment system, after winning a $900 millión cóntract fróm General Mótórs. Hówever, while GM will be the first cómpany tó utilize the new system, Harman CEO Dinesh Paliwal said in a recent cónference call with AN that óther autómakers can adópt the technólógy "óne life cycle behind." Chevrólet and Cadillac are expected tó be the first vehicles tó implement the new system.

Tó keep the Andróid-based system up- tó- date thróughóut the vehicle's life cycle, an app stóre will be set up, letting the infótainment system stay technólógically relevant. "Apps will be develóped by General Mótórs, Harman and a bunch óf óther third parties, nót just Góógle and Apple," said Paliwal. At CES earlier this year, GM annóunced its plans tó launch its AppShóp service fór current MyLink infótainment systems, which wóuld have próvided dównlóadable third-party apps. In July, GM delayed thóse plans, claiming the service didn't meet cónsumer experience expectatións.

As GM was óne óf several autómakers backing the develópment óf Andróid Autó, Harman's system will be rólled óut alóngside the smart phóne-based platfórm. Autómótive News says GM will óffer bóth Andróid Autó and Apple CarPlay, thóugh the autómaker has nót specified which módels will get what. GM currently óffers Apple's Siri Eyes Free system ón sóme módels. This system, which helps curb distracted driving by utilizing vóice cómmands, was first intróduced ón the 2013 Chevrólet Spark and Sónic and 2015 Chevrólet Trax. Thanks tó a steering wheel-móunted buttón, drivers are able tó access Siri tó perfórm a number óf iPhóne features.
